Output 31c248a8bf8e7eb18d62b07c666d49ac444403c71663305bebbb044a7faa901e:2

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9af6cffd636b11c97a7d9698c2f433f8de40731 OP_EQUAL
address
3MY2hy5kiVsW3E93dCtV63bLdCvWeju9EL
transaction
31c248a8bf8e7eb18d62b07c666d49ac444403c71663305bebbb044a7faa901e
confirmations
165627
spent
true